Not into bingos. If you sell a pin fairly priced you'll get tons of offers. If you sell a pin on pinside and tell people you accept trades you get pin and arcade trade offers. If you put a pin up for sale on Craigslist/Facebook you get... well... other things.
I recently listed a Fish Tales on Pinside/Facebook/Craigslist. I had over 40 offers within a week

The end result is that I went with someone who offered me the equivalent of $3,600 in cash and arcade trade (got my Golden Tee delivered) and came in person to test, pay cash, and load his vehicle with my help.
